How do I become an IV hydration nurse?

To become an IV hydration nurse, you typically need to be a registered nurse (RN) with a valid license, complete specialized training in IV therapy and hydration techniques, and obtain any required certifications such as Basic Life Support (BLS) or IV therapy certification. Gaining experience in clinical settings and staying updated on best practices can also enhance your qualifications for this role.

Can an RN start an IV hydration business?

An RN can start an IV hydration business if they have the appropriate licensure, training, and certifications required by their state or country. They must adhere to healthcare regulations, maintain proper infection control practices, and often need to operate within a licensed medical facility or under a medical director's supervision. Business licensing and liability insurance are also necessary considerations for establishing such a service.

What is the difference between Trainee Rn Iv Hydration vs Registered Nurse Iv Hydration?

AspectTrainee Rn Iv HydrationRegistered Nurse Iv Hydration
CredentialsEnrolled in nursing program, limited certificationLicensed RN with full certification
Work EnvironmentSupervised clinical or training settingsIndependent practice in clinics, hospitals
Job ResponsibilitiesAssisting with IV procedures under supervisionPerforming IV insertions, patient assessments, and care

In summary, a Trainee Rn Iv Hydration is a nursing student gaining hands-on experience under supervision, while a Registered Nurse Iv Hydration is a fully licensed professional performing IV hydration independently. The main differences lie in certification, responsibilities, and work autonomy.
